Fee Reimbursement Scheme (also called as Post-matric Scholarship Scheme) is a student education sponsorship Programme by Government of Andhra Pradesh. It supports students belonging to economically weaker sections in the state.In 2012-13, more than 600,000 students in professional colleges were covered under the scheme, including around 150,000 students
